Discover a true tropical oasis on the beautiful Sapphire Coast at Villa Spa Holiday Resort. Situated on five acres of immaculately maintained grounds in the seaside village of Illovo Beach, this is a destination that truly lives up to its name. From the moment you arrive, you are welcomed into a world of lush, rolling lawns and beautiful, established trees, creating a serene, park-like environment that feels both luxurious and profoundly peaceful. The resort is a thriving sanctuary for an abundance of birdlife, adding a constant, beautiful soundtrack to your stay. The camping experience is designed to meet the high expectations of the astute and discerning camper. The sites are wonderfully spacious, level, and covered in soft green grass, giving you plenty of room to spread out and enjoy the freedom of the area. A generous canopy of shade provides a cool and inviting atmosphere for your caravan, motorhome, or tent. Every site is a hub of modern convenience, equipped with a reliable 15-amp electricity supply (using a standard three-pin plug), a nearby water tap, and a portable braai for that classic holiday barbecue. What truly sets Villa Spa apart is its commitment to providing a seamless, hotel-like level of service and cleanliness. The two large ablution facilities are impeccably maintained, as are the two convenient sculleries for dishwashing. For the ultimate in holiday convenience, a staff-operated laundromat is available on-site, taking care of your laundry for you so you can focus on relaxing. It is this unwavering attention to detail, from the pristine grounds to the non-smoking facilities, that makes Villa Spa a leading resort for a truly comfortable and rejuvenating coastal escape.

As its name perfectly suggests, Eagle View Caravan Park offers a truly spectacular, bird's-eye perspective of one of KwaZulu-Natal's most iconic landscapes. Nestled right on the edge of the magnificent Valley of a Thousand Hills, this is a destination that will take your breath away. It’s a true hidden gem, a place where you can escape the hustle and bustle of city life and immerse yourself in a world of thick forests, lush greens, and profound tranquility. It’s the perfect, scenic sanctuary for a complete digital detox and a soulful recharge. The park is a paradise for nature lovers and those who seek to explore on foot. Scenic hiking trails wind their way through the beautiful landscape, leading you to unspoiled, panoramic views and the magical sight of majestic waterfalls. The entire area is a haven for birdlife, and you can spend hours simply relaxing at your campsite, soaking in the incredible scenery and the peaceful, natural atmosphere. It’s a place that invites you to slow down, breathe deeply, and appreciate the finer aspects of the beautiful KZN countryside. The camping experience is designed to be comfortable, flexible, and social. A generous number of powered sites are available, and campers are advised to bring a standard caravan electrical socket to connect. For those who prefer an off-grid experience, a selection of non-powered sites is also available. The ablution facilities are thoughtfully equipped with hot showers, wheelchair access, a scullery, and even a communal bar fridge. The social heart of the camp is its big, welcoming lapa with a fireplace - the perfect spot to gather with new friends. With a wonderfully warm and welcoming pet-friendly policy, the entire family is invited to enjoy this spectacular view from the top.

Since 1963, Happy Wanderers Holiday Resort has been a cherished destination for families seeking the quintessential South Coast holiday. This is a place steeped in a legacy of happy memories, a private paradise situated on an incredible 500-meter stretch of its own unspoiled beach in the tranquil village of Kelso. Located just 65 kilometers south of Durban, it’s an accessible escape to a world where the golden sands and the warm Indian Ocean are your personal playground. It’s a classic resort that has perfected the art of the carefree family getaway. The camping experience is designed to be both wonderfully diverse and deeply connected to the sea. The park is nestled under a beautiful, protected canopy of indigenous Milkwood trees, and from your site, you can wake up to the unmistakable, beckoning call of the ocean just meters away. The resort understands that every camper has a different preference, offering a fantastic variety of sites to suit every need. You can choose your perfect spot, whether you prefer the softness of grass, the classic feel of sand, or the all-weather convenience of a concrete slab, with options for full sun, partial shade, or deep, cool cover. Beyond the magnificent beach, the resort is a self-contained world of leisure and convenience. A stunning on-site restaurant and a welcoming bar provide a fantastic social hub for guests, offering a delicious alternative to camp cooking. A full suite of facilities and activities for the whole family ensures that there is always something to do, from relaxing by the pool to exploring the pristine coastline. With a range of accommodation including self-catering apartments and private log cabins, Happy Wanderers truly is the perfect location for a memorable holiday for every member of the family.

Step into the heart of South Africa's most storied landscapes at Kwa-Rie Resort. Perfectly positioned in Dundee, this tranquil retreat serves as the ideal gateway to the historic KwaZulu-Natal Battlefields. Its central location, midway between Newcastle and Ladysmith, makes it an incredibly convenient base from which to explore the hallowed grounds of Isandlwana, Rorke's Drift, and other significant sites. The resort offers a peaceful sanctuary, a place where you can spend your days immersed in the region's poignant history and return to a quiet, comfortable haven in the evening to reflect and unwind. The resort offers an intimate and well-maintained camping area, ensuring a personal and uncrowded atmosphere. With a limited number of level sites laid out on seasonal grass, the park feels spacious and relaxed. To help preserve this pleasant environment, guests are kindly asked to use a net ground sheet. The campsites are shaded by a smattering of trees, and each one is thoughtfully equipped with its own power point and a convenient water tap located on or near the site. Every stand also features its own braai facility, ready for you to bring your own grid and cook up a feast under the vast African sky. Supporting your stay are clean and comfortable communal ablutions, providing all the simple but essential comforts of hot-water showers, basins, and flushing toilets. A dedicated scullery for washing dishes and available laundry facilities add a layer of convenience, especially for those on a longer tour of the region. In keeping with its welcoming atmosphere, the resort is also happy to accommodate pets by prior arrangement. It is this combination of a prime historical location, thoughtful amenities, and a peaceful setting that makes Kwa-Rie the perfect base for your journey into the past.

Nestled in the rolling green hills just 1.3 kilometres from Ramsgate's famous Blue Flag beach, Fairhills Caravan Park offers a wonderfully tranquil holiday escape. This is a place where you can unwind in a lush, park-like setting, surrounded by abundant birdlife, while still being just minutes from the sand and surf of the lagoon and ocean. The resort features 44 campsites of various sizes, thoughtfully laid out to accommodate everything from large caravans to smaller tents, with water taps always close at hand. The facilities show a real consideration for camper convenience. A large main ablution block services the upper terrace, while two smaller ablution blocks are strategically placed on the lower levels, ensuring no one has a long walk in the middle of the night. On-site, the resort is geared for family fun with a sparkling swimming pool, trampoline, jungle gym, and even its own nature trail. A unique and charming touch is the "honesty library" located in the laundry room, offering a selection of books to enjoy while you wait. While not all sites have built-in braais, portable units are readily available from the office, ensuring that an evening braai is always an option. It’s this blend of peaceful surroundings and thoughtful amenities that makes Fairhills a beloved South Coast destination.

Discover the heart of the KwaZulu-Natal Midlands at Glensheiling, a true country resort nestled within the famous Midlands Meander, just a short drive from Nottingham Road. This is not just a place to park your caravan; it’s an invitation to experience a peaceful, farm-style retreat where you can reconnect with nature and family. The resort offers approximately 30 spacious, grassed campsites with electrical points, providing a comfortable base for your adventures. The land itself tells stories; you can wander trails through indigenous forests, discover a stone hideout wall used during the Boer War, or see the very grooves in the stream where Zulu warriors once sharpened their spears. For keen anglers, the well-stocked bass dam is a major draw, while the boats and raft make it an irresistible swimming spot for the whole family. For children, Glensheiling is a paradise of old-fashioned adventure. Days are spent zipping down the adventurous "foofy slide," building secret forts in the pine forest, enjoying pony rides, or challenging the family to a game on the giant outdoor chessboard. While the kids play, parents can relax on the "Deck on the Dam," soaking up the sun and serene views, making it a perfectly balanced holiday for everyone.

Ilanga Resort & Caravan Park offers a classic and wonderfully peaceful seaside escape on the beautiful KZN South Coast, with direct access to the beach at Banana Beach. This is not a bustling, high-energy family resort, but rather a tranquil haven that is particularly popular with visitors who appreciate a quieter, more traditional coastal holiday. It is a place where the primary soundtrack is the gentle rhythm of the Indian Ocean, providing the perfect setting for a truly restorative getaway. The resort provides a selection of level campsites, offering a mix of grass and solid ground, with some stands enjoying welcome shade while others are more open to the sun. To help maintain the grassed areas, campers are encouraged to use a net-style groundsheet. Each site is equipped with a 15-amp power point (it’s a good idea to bring an extension cord of at least 15 metres), and features its own dedicated braai facility, perfect for an evening cook-up. The camping experience is supported by clean and well-maintained communal ablution blocks, which provide reliable hot water. Life at Ilanga is about embracing the simple pleasures of the coast. Days are spent with long walks along the beach, fishing from the shore, or simply relaxing at your campsite with a good book while enjoying the uninterrupted ocean views.
